Report: China will outspend US on AI research by end of 2018

The US House Oversight and Reform IT Subcommittee today released the results of a months-long investigation into Federal investment and oversight in artificial intelligence. There's a lot to unpack here, and most of it is bad. TL;DR: If the Trump administration doesn't make drastic changes China will pass us in AI R&D spending this year, and will likely lead the globe in AI technologies long before the 2030 deadline its government issued last year. On a day when the leaders of the free world openly laughed at US President Donald Trump as he claimed to have accomplished more than "almost any other" administration in US history, a bipartisan effort back home to make the White House care about the future took the form of a research paper. Congressman Will Hurd, a Texas Republican, and Representative Robin Kelly, an Illinois Democrat, published "Rise of the Machines: Artificial Intelligence and its Growing Impact on U.S. Policy," after spending the majority of 2018 holding subcommittee hearings to interview AI experts.
